BEC manuscript submissions - Living Communications

A manuscript may be submitted in conjunction with a presentation, or as a standalone submission regardless of whether you attend the conference.
Dear authors:
We will need your help for ensuring a quick turnaround and adherence to timelines to prepare a printed issue for distribution at the conference.
In addition to contributions from the academic world, companies and particularly start-ups involved in the field of bioenergetics are invited to present their advancements in an Industrial Exhibition at the conference venue and to communicate their innovations in the Bioblast 2022: BEC Inaugural Issue.
You may consider your short-term (end of March) and page-limited (4 to 8 pages) primary contribution to Bioblast 2022 as a Living Communication. Our goal is a continuously evolving BEC article collection on Bioenergetics โ€“ past and future perspectives. Open Access, no page charges, no publication fees, with Open Peer Review. Starting with a 4 to 8 page short contribution to BEC (plus optional Supplement and Open Access data repository), you may edit your article for future editions to keep it 'immortal', which may expand, evolve, and thus contribute to a unique collection on the Bioblasts. BEC has subscribed to DORA to support a change in the world of scientific communication - towards empowerment of Gentle Science instead of slavery in the empires of the publishing industry with yesteryear's paywall journals.
